…on 2018-11-15 in order to kill all l2 private servers with one fell swoop.

 

If you are running a low, mid or high rate server based on any chronicle before GoD, seasonal (regular progression resets) or not, the doomsday clock for your server HAS STARTED COUNTING DOWN.

 

Features:

  • Concentrated hunting grounds (no more spending 97% of time running and 3% attacking mobs) - less NPCs in total so server can easily handle 10k+ online
  • NPC buffers in hunting grounds
  • Allied NPCs in hunting grounds (healing you, attacking mobs without XP penalty)
  • GM shop with literally everything
  • GM buffers in towns with 7h full buffs
  • One-click class change
  • Global teleporters in every town (to all other towns and to all hunting grounds, grouped by area)
  • No enchant value limits (yes, you can finally do that +200 Soul Bow on an official server)
  • F2P

 

In less than three days (of total online time), the server (Aden) has reached and exceeded the 7000 players online milestone - something that was never reached (and will never be, as their popularity is dwindling now) by recently released standard classic TI/Giran servers in NCWest.

 

Innova has already started porting Bloody Classic features to the international Seven Signs client (Korea is already on Fafurion/Secret of the Empire/Saviors) to facilitate a release ASAP.

    • This post originally appeared on zupyak.   If you're diving into MLB The Show 25, you know how essential stubs are for building a powerhouse team. Whether you're aiming to snag elite players, upgrade your roster, or stock up on packs, stubs are the key to success. The good news? You don't need to spend real money to earn them. With a little strategy and effort, you can rake in stubs and dominate the diamond.  Here are the top five strategies to maximize your MLB The Show stub earnings and create the ultimate team without breaking the bank.    1. Earning Stubs with Diamond Quest Diamond Quest is a goldmine for stubs. By completing challenges in this mode, you can earn Diamond cards, which often have high sell values. Once you've earned these cards, sell them in the in-game Marketplace for a quick influx of stubs. Additionally, the packs you earn from Diamond Quest can be opened for more cards to sell or use in collections.   2. Completing Conquest Maps Conquest Maps are another excellent way to rack up stubs. Focus on capturing territories and completing map-specific goals. Many maps offer hidden rewards, including packs and stubs, which can significantly boost your earnings. You don't always need to conquer Strongholds—simply taking over territories can yield great rewards.   3. Flipping Cards in the Marketplace The Marketplace is your playground for flipping cards. Look for cards with a significant gap between their "Buy Now" and "Sell Now" prices. Place a Buy Order slightly above the current "Sell Now" price, then list the card for a "Sell Order" just below the "Buy Now" price. After the 10% Marketplace tax, you'll still make a profit. This strategy works best with high-value cards but requires patience and consistency.     4. Leveraging Player Exchanges Player Exchanges are an underrated method for earning stubs. Purchase cheap Silver cards near their quick-sell value, then exchange them for Gold players. These Gold players can either be used in your lineup or sold for a profit. This method is especially effective early in the game when Gold cards hold higher value.   5. Selling Things You Don't Need Don't let unused items clutter your inventory. Regularly check for duplicate cards, equipment, or other items you don't need. Sell these through the Marketplace to free up space and earn extra stubs. Even Bronze and Silver cards can add up over time, so don't overlook them. With these strategies, you'll be well on your way to building a dream team without spending real money.
